deloitte just announced the availability of audit technology for smaller accounting firms through a new venture it recently formed.

deloitte created auvenir as an in-house startup and tasked it with developing its own auditing technology that could be offered to small firms. deloitte is starting with a north american launch of the technology, known as the auvenir audit smarter platform, which leverages artificial intelligence to help auditors with their work.

the 2016 cpa firm management association it survey* pointed out that a surprising 23 percent of responding firms had transitioned to an outsourced cloud architecture. this trend points to internal it personnel being disintermediated as they have been unable to keep up with today’s required skill set for improving firm processes as well as technical skill needed to optimizing remote access, security and disaster recovery for the firm, which firms seem to struggle with constantly.
